Family Bonds.. (part 3)


I wake up with a start. I quickly get dressed and rush to the hospital.

I run into my mother's room.. I thank God that she looks better.
Sitting down besides her, I take her hands in mine.
"I love you mum.." I say. "You read my diary, didn't you?" She asks. Her voice is a whisper. It is lifeless and weak. I nod my head, not being able to speak.
She lifts my hand and kisses it. She then places it over her chest. Her heart beats are slow..
"I'm sorry." I say.
"Don't be. I always knew you would come back someday." She smiles.

We look at each other..tears fill in both our eyes. I hold her hand tight.
"You will be fine mum. You need to fight." I say.
"Now that you are here, I will fight.."
..........

(A week later)
I walk into my room. It looks brighter now. I lift the picture that was hanging on the wall. I replace it, and hang it back.
I look at it and smile.
It's a picture of a girl holding her parents hands. It's a picture of a happy family.
The girl is me. The two people on my sides are the ones who never stopped caring..

It's my parent's anniversary today. I bake a cake for my mother. I help her cut the cake and feed her. She's happy. She looks beautiful.
Once she falls asleep, I cuddle her into my arms and fall asleep besides her.

I will keep her safe, just the way she did when I was a kid..
